Here is the story...We usually fly out Christmas Day so I am used to the craze of booking as soon as SW calendar comes out. We either fly out of Hartford or Providence. This year however, we leave for WDW on the 29th of December. SW does not have their calendar out for 2 more weeks. Jet Blue does have their calendar out until 1/3.

We need 8 tickets--5 together, and 3 singles, just in case 20 something kids are unable to go. Jet Blue has a 1 way for 139 for that day. It has been like that for 2 weeks--I have been watching! :laughing: Do I book now and wait to see if they come down and get a credit or wait for SW to come out in 2 weeks? Does anyone have any experience with this time frame. Again, I am used to being on the computer and getting a bit better than this for 1 way on Christmas Day.

I'm not sure you can compare rates this year to last year. I'm seeing rates that are 50% - 90% higher than last year! My rule is: if I see a rate I can live with, I book it.

With buying so many seats I wouldn't be surprised if you can only get a few seats at the lowest rate as well. So, somthing to keep in mind.

I would pick any random date and compare JetBlue and SW prices; if they are close then chances are SW will be close to Jetblue for 12/29. Two weeks isn't going to kill you, so I would just wait.
